We are excited to announce the release of VoxBo 1.8.2, for Linux, OSX, and Cygwin (Windows). This release is available both as a patch and as a full release. Both versions include all the binaries, but the patch is missing some redundant stuff, and doesn't overwrite any of your configuration files when you unpack it.

Here's what's new as of 1.8.2:

Exciting new features

  • the plots you see in programs like vecview, gdw, and vbview support a bunch of new features:
    • click on the graph to see the exact value at any point. hold down the shift key to prevent interpolation
    • if multiple series are plotted, use the spacebar to select one
    • the F1, F2, F3, and F4 keys can be used to select how the data are plotted
    • you can now use the arrow keys to zoom and scroll
  • vbsim, a little hack for creating test data, is now much more usable
  • vbdumpstats has some new features and fixes:
    • defaults to same mean norm and detrend settings as original GLM, and tells you what it's doing
    • ignores voxels without data
    • should be a lot faster for large masks
    • you can now specify multiple masks, contrasts, and GLMs, and get all combinations reported
  • vbconv now supports extracting multiple 3D volumes from a 4D file, using the -i flag. vbconv also now honors the -f and -n flags for floating point conversion and removing NaNs/Infs
  • the scheduler will now prevent any sequence with more than 10 bad jobs from running.
  • vbmaskmunge will now calculate difference images between 3D volumes

Bug fixes

  • vbsingle: various bugs fixed, a few new features (see help)
  • vbview: numerous fixes, including:
    • numerous non-subtle bugs in time series display, including power spectrum display
    • residual plot for regions formerly showed average residual, now shows residual from regression of average signal
    • window size issues on OSX and Cygwin, and other cosmetic bugs fixed
  • glminfo now supports the -l flag for extra detail on your glm
  • a bug that could cause occasional NaNs in vbstatmap fixed
  • NIfTI orientation coding (sform/qform) are now preserved properly, and setorigin can set non-integer origins for NIfTI files
  • DICOM import is a bit more inclusive about what it will accept
  • vbperminfo should be a tiny bit faster
  • misc/xinetd.vbsrvd restored to the distribution
  • bug in command line parsing in jobtype files fixed
  • voxbo.log file moved back into etc/logs directory, you can delete etc/voxbo.log
  • resample is now available for OSX, there are still issues with realign and norm
  • a possible source of scheduler instability has been squashed
  • many small bugs fixed
